Farnsworth Middle is a State/Public serving middle age pupils, located in Sheboygan, Sheboygan County. The school has 514 pupils enrolled. It is part of the Sheboygan Area School District school district. It serves grades 6โ8 in an urban setting. The school employs 40.2 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 12.8:1. 30% of students are proficient in reading. 20% are proficient in maths. Farnsworth Middle enrolls 514 students across grades 6โ8. The student body is 51% male and 49% female. A teaching staff of 40.2 full-time-equivalent teachers supports the school, giving a student-teacher ratio of 12.8:1.
By race and ethnicity, the student body is 37% White, 25% Asian and 20% Hispanic or Latino.

307 of the school's 514 students (60%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Of these, 270 qualify for free lunch and 37 for a reduced price. The school participates in the National School Lunch Program.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.
Farnsworth Middle is located in an urban setting (NCES locale: City, Small). Virtual instruction: Supplemental Virtual. The school runs a schoolwide Title I program, which provides federal funding to support students from low-income families. Farnsworth Middle is one of 25 schools in Sheboygan Area School District, based in Sheboygan, Wisconsin. The district serves 9,285 students district-wide and employs 702 full-time-equivalent teachers. With 514 students, Farnsworth Middle is larger than the district average of about 371 students per school.
